About Mattei Compressors Inc
The industry's leading provider of innovative rotary vane technology. Mattei pioneered the development of the rotary vane compressor in 1958. Since then, for more than 50 years, these machines have been used worldwide in nearly every industry and market. What Is the Cost of Living Near Baltimore?

Understanding the cost of living near Baltimore is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Mattei Compressors Inc.
Baltimore's Cost of Living Index is approximately 91.8 (8.2% less expensive than US average; 18.8% less than MD average). Major city, historic, affordable housing in many areas, but varies greatly by neighborhood. MTA bus/Light Rail/Metro Subway.
